Some of our friends made up this marinade but weren't able to give me exact measurements. I experimented until I came up with this recipe, which tastes as good as theirs. Patty Collins, Morgantown, Indiana Ingredients:
2 cups salsa |
1/4 cup sugar |
4-1/2 teaspoons sweet-and-sour sauce |
1 tablespoon vegetable oil |
1 tablespoon green taco sauce |
2 teaspoons balsamic vinegar |
dash hot pepper sauce |
2 pork tenderloins (about 1 pound each) |
Directions:
1. In a small bowl, combine the first seven ingredients. Set aside 1 cup for dipping; cover and refrigerate. Pour the remaining marinade into a large resealable plastic bag; add pork. Seal bag and turn to coat. Refrigerate overnight. 2. Prepare grill for indirect heat. Drain and discard marinade. Grill pork, covered, over medium heat for 30-40 minutes or until a meat thermometer reads 160°. Let stand for 10 minutes before slicing. Warm reserved marinade; serve with pork. Yield: 6-8 servings. |
